JHW Steel copper composite self-lubricating version
High strength copper alloy is sintered or cast on the surface of high-quality carbon steel plate as the substrate, and dispersed sintered or embedded with solid lubricant on its working surface according to the operating conditions. This manufacturing process achieves complete metallurgical bonding between copper and steel, which has stronger wear resistance and lubricity compared to traditional integral copper alloy products, lower cost, stronger stability of the bottom steel matrix, and longer overall service life. While reducing material costs, it also improves its load-bearing capacity.

  • Material introduction
    1.Combining the wear resistance of copper alloys with the high mechanical strength of steel;;
    2.Different copper alloy materials, including low friction lead copper alloys, can be cast according to the requirements of the working conditions;
    3.Due to the different friction coefficients of the inner and outer materials, it can prevent the bearing from shifting and running around the outer circle under high load and low-speed conditions;
    4.Solid lubricants can be covered or embedded on the working surface as needed to achieve self lubrication;
    5.Compared to pure copper sleeves, it has a cost advantage and saves resources;
    6.Post processing can be carried out, such as heat treatment of steel substrate, alloy layer machining, etc;
    7.Copper alloy casting can be carried out in one or more layers on different or complex surfaces according to design requirements;
    8.Similar to traditional copper sleeves in terms of usage characteristics, it can be suitable for working conditions under different temperatures and lubrication conditions;
    9.Compared to pure copper sleeves, it has better mechanical load-bearing performance, especially in terms of impact strength.
